Q: Is 100,845,536 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 100,845,536 is a composite number.

Why is 100,845,536 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 100,845,536 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 11 16 22 32 44 88 176 352 286,493 572,986 1,145,972 2,291,944 3,151,423 4,583,888 6,302,846 9,167,776 12,605,692 25,211,384 50,422,768 and 100,845,536, with no remainder.

Since 100,845,536 cannot be divided by just 1 and 100,845,536, it is a composite number.
